| Description | EDIMAX BR-6428nS V3 1.15 is vulnerable to Command Injection. An authenticated attacker with access to the network can submit crafted input to the WLAN configuration functionality. Due to insufficient input validation, the attacker is able to execute arbitrary system commands on the device. | |
